Job Description

Hampton Farms offers a structured, people-first HR role in Franklin, VA (onsite), supporting recruiting, onboarding, and day-to-day HR administration within a manufacturing setting. You will help create a positive employee experience while partnering with Corporate HR and Payroll to keep hiring and HR processes accurate, compliant, and confidential.

What you’ll do

  • Own the full recruitment workflow, including job postings, applicant screening, interview coordination, and candidate communications.
  • Coordinate career fairs and other recruiting initiatives.
  • Coordinate pre-employment steps such as background checks and drug testing.
  • Lead new hire orientation and onboarding to support an engaged start for employees.
  • Prepare offer letters and maintain accurate recruiting records.
  • Maintain employee records and HRIS data with an emphasis on confidentiality and accuracy.
  • Assist employees and supervisors with questions related to HRIS, payroll, benefits, and timekeeping.
  • Review employee time records prior to payroll processing.
  • Support HR compliance by assisting with job descriptions, employee status changes, and HR compliance activities.
  • Coordinate employee recognition programs, including Employee of the Month, and create employee communications such as quarterly newsletters.
  • Support Workers’ Compensation administration and other HR projects as assigned.
  • Partner with Corporate HR and Payroll to support compliance with company policies and employment laws.
  • Provide customer service by welcoming visitors, applicants, vendors, and employees and answering incoming phone calls; maintain office supplies.
  • Complete additional administrative duties as needed.

Work environment

  • Primarily office-based, with regular time spent in a food manufacturing environment.
  • Facility exclusively processes peanuts and tree nuts, and employees must be able to safely work where exposure to airborne and contact allergens is unavoidable.
  • Production areas may have varying temperatures and moderate noise levels.
  • Occasional travel may be required.
